目的:分析外周血Th17、Th1及相关细胞因子表达水平和支气管哮喘(bronchial asthma,BA)发生、发展的相关性研究。方法:回顾选取我院收治的BA病例57份,称作BA组,另选取呼吸系统正常的病例55例为对照组,检测两组入选者的外周血IL-2、TNF-α、Th17、IL-6、Th1指标表达差异,并进行多因素回归分析。结果:BA组Th17(0.62±1.67)%、Th1(1.45±0.48)%及Th1/Th17(2.33±1.28)均显著低于对照组(P均<0.05);BA组TNF-α(27.46±8.12)pg/mL、IL-6(11.69±2.14)pg/mL表达量显著高于对照组,IL-2(2.58±3.89)pg/mL、IFN-γ(3.74±6.15)pg/mL含量均显著低于对照组(P均<0.05);经Logistic回归分析,TNF-α、IL-6、IFN-γ、Th1/Th17、IL-2均和BA有密切相关性(P均<0.05)。结论:IL-2、IFN-γ、Th1/Th17、TNF-α、IL-6表达水平均与BA有密切关联,可能是参与BA发病的主要原因,及早进行Th17、Th1及相关细胞因子检查有助于明确病情。
